  • Abstract
    A lowest order magnetic dipole mode isolated cylindrical DRA was investigated experimentally and using the surface equivalence principal and finite element method solvers in a commercially available software. The height to radius ratio of these DRAs for a fixed resonant frequency was found to vary non-linearly, as predicted by prior theory. An initial 30mm high, 15.4mm radius horizontally polarized DRA was prepared for 2.3GHz band licensed video communications from a small UAV to ground station.
